Developing a bi-objective model of the closed-loop supply chain network with green supplier selection and disassembly of products: The impact of parts reliability and product greenness on the recovery network
Journal of Manufacturing Systems(2015)
Abstract
•A bi-objective MILP model is used to study trade-offs between greenness and profit.•Pareto-optimal solutions generated by the ε-constraint method show the trade-offs.•Sensitivity analysis done to help the decision maker in selecting key parameters.•Experiments depicts interactions between flow of parts, reliability and greenness.
